University of California, San Francisco – Data Scientist

Company Information: UCSF is a world-renowned medical school with 7 Nobel Prize winners, 31 members of the National Academy of Sciences, 69 members of the Institute of Medicine, and 30 members of the Academy of Arts and Sciences. UCSF is located in Silicon Valley, the heart of innovation. The University of California is an Equal Opportunity/Affirmative Action Employer. All qualified applicants will receive consideration for employment without regard to race, color, religion, sex, sexual orientation, gender identity, national origin, disability, age, or protected veteran status.

Position Title: Data Scientist

Duties and Responsibilities: We are seeking talented post-doctoral researchers and data scientists to join our interdisciplinary research team on an ambitious multi-year mission to develop cutting-edge computational tools for monitoring, diagnosing, and updating ML/AI algorithms. The team is led by Drs. Jean Feng and Suchi Saria. Other team members include faculty across UCSF, JHU, and Northwell with expertise in ML/AI/statistics and medicine, including Drs. Fan Xia, Julian Hong, Lucas Zier, Arjun Sondhi, and more.

Primary responsibilities include:
* Architect, implement, and maintain ETL pipelines that extract data from the Electronic Health Record (EHR) system and support monitoring, diagnosing, and updating ML/AI systems in real-world clinical settings
* Design and implement robust, scalable software libraries and data pipelines
* Collaborate with deployment teams to integrate tools into real-world systems

Position Qualifications: The data scientist position requires a BS (preferably MS) in computer science, data science, (bio)statistics, or related areas. We are looking for someone who:
* has a strong software engineering background
* has experience in building ETL pipelines
* is excited to get their hands dirty with real-world clinical data
* is able to work collaboratively with a team

Salary Range: 85000-120000

Benefits: The position (100% funded) will be for two years, with potential for continuation. Salary and benefits are competitive.
